Japanese government may lift the state of emergency

The Japanese government may lift the state of emergency due to the coronavirus.

Axar.az informs that the statement came from Prime Minister Yoshihide Suga.

The state of emergency is in effect in 19 prefectures, including the most populous, Tokyo and Osaka.

The Prime Minister noted that the number of coronavirus infections has decreased: "The decision to lift the state of emergency can be made in a few days."
